Simon Foxton: From Styling Icon to AI Image-Maker

artist · 2026-05-01

Simon Foxton, a well-known menswear stylist and art director, has been shaping fashion visuals since the mid-1980s and is now venturing into AI-generated images. After graduating from Central Saint Martins in 1983, he co-founded Bazooka! and made significant contributions to i-D magazine, working closely with photographer Nick Knight. His work has also appeared in The Face, Arena Homme+, and for brands like Levi's and Stone Island. Foxton discovered Edward Enninful on the Tube, who later became his assistant and model. A memorable 1991 shoot with Jason Evans featuring Enninful is now housed in the Tate and Victoria and Albert Museum. Retired from commercial fashion, Foxton has spent the last two years exploring AI, focusing on queer male imagery and club culture. He often credits a fictional photographer, Boss Tweed, for his AI works. Recently, he teamed up with Nick Knight for an AI fashion editorial in Numero NY, set to launch in fall 2025. For Foxton, this AI exploration is more about personal satisfaction than a career shift.

Key facts

  • Simon Foxton is a menswear stylist and art director who worked with i-D, Nick Knight, Jason Evans, and Alasdair McLellan.
  • He graduated from Central Saint Martins in 1983 and co-founded the label Bazooka! with Cheryl Eastap.
  • Foxton discovered Edward Enninful on the London Underground; Enninful became his assistant and model.
  • A 1991 i-D shoot by Foxton and Jason Evans featuring Enninful is in the Tate and V&A permanent collections.
  • Foxton convinced artist Steve McQueen to model as a student.
  • He has been using AI (Midjourney) for two years, creating images under the pseudonym Boss Tweed.
  • Foxton collaborated with Nick Knight on an AI editorial for the inaugural issue of Numero NY in fall 2025.
  • He tags his AI content with disclaimers and does not intend to deceive.
